WebAn alternative term is ‘racialised minorities’, which draws attention to the racialisation of people of colour and serves to highlight the discursive power of whiteness. As such the term is a critique of whiteness and therefore a form of resistance. The term ‘Black’ can also be used politically to refer to non-White groups as a unifying ...
